In Rhode Island, you can make a living trust to avoid probate for virtually any asset you own?real estate, bank accounts, vehicles, and so on. You need to create a trust document (it's similar to a will), naming someone to take over as trustee after your death (called a successor trustee).

A last will and testament?also simply called a will?communicates a person's last wishes for the time after his death. However, Rhode Island law allows for certain parties to dispute the legality of the document with proper grounds, and this is called contesting a will.

If you are in possession of a will of a deceased person, you must either file it with the appropriate court or deliver it to the person named in the will as executor, as under Rhode Island law the will is to be filed within 30 days after death.

The length of time an executor has to settle an estate in Rhode Island can vary significantly, usually ranging from several months to over a year, depending on factors such as the size and complexity of the estate, the clarity of the will, and whether or not the probate process is contested.

Spouses and children have primary inheritance rights under Rhode Island intestate succession laws. There are even rules that allow a spouse a life estate in any real property owned solely by the deceased to protect their living arrangements while preserving its long-term ownership for the children in the family.

Signature: The will must be signed by the testator or by someone else in the testator's name in his presence, by his express direction. Witnesses: A Rhode Island will must be signed by at least two individuals present at the same time who subscribe to the will in the presence of the testator.
